The Jameson Land Basin, located on the eastern coast of Greenland, is considered one of the largest underexplored onshore basins in the world. Greenland Energy holds a 100% working interest in a 5,559-square-kilometer license in the basin, which has been de-risked by previous exploration. The company plans to drill an exploration well in 2025, targeting a prospective resource of over 1.5 billion barrels of oil. Such a discovery could significantly alter the supply dynamics for North Atlantic markets, reducing reliance on transit through chokepoints like the Strait of Hormuz.
